Overweight/Oversize Permits

The Florida Department of Transportation (DOT), in an effort to streamline the permitting process, has gone to a web-based permit application system for overweight and over dimensional permits. Information on this process can be found at www.dot.state.fl.us/mcco. Once you reach this site, click on the Registration & Permits link in the Programs section.
